Encourage a diverse and vibrant economy emphasizing <br /> agriculture and sustainable economies. <br /> The Land Study Bureau has classified the soil as "C" or fair. <br /> Consistent with this designation, the subject area has been planted <br /> with coffee and some fruit trees. The B&B, with its active coffee <br /> farm, would enable guests to enjoy and learn more of the coffee <br /> industry. In a way, too, it would make it more feasible for the <br /> applicant to live on site and work the farm more intensively. <br /> g. Promote effective governance. <br /> This principle is not applicable. <br /> The CDP also discusses strategies for the "enhancement" of the <br /> agricultural industry in Kona, The requested use would be consistent <br /> with two of these strategies. One is the protection of agricultural <br /> lands, as no subdivision is being proposed and the existing <br /> agricultural activity on the site would be maintained. The other relates <br /> to agricultural tourism, which this request would be promoting. <br /> Accordingly, the requested use would further the agricultural <br /> objectives of both the General Plan and Kona CDP. As such,, no <br /> action or amendment to either document would be needed to <br /> effectuate this project. <br /> D. County Zoning <br /> The County zoning designation of the site is Agricultural (A-1a). The <br /> minimum lot size for this zoning district is one (1) acre. The subject <br /> property consists of nearly 1.312 acres and is thus considered a <br /> conforming lot of record. <br /> Within the A-1a zone, the applicant's existing uses such as the farm <br /> dwelling and coffee farm are permitted uses.
